NEWS
js-controller 2 jetzt für alle im Stable
-
@Stabilostick Vielen Dank für die ausführliche Erklärung, seltsamerweise (ist bei mir aber schon immer so???) ist die neu erstellte admin.0 Instanz an die IP 0.0.0.0 gebunden und ich muss dann noch zusätzlich
iobroker set admin.0 --bind 192.168.0.20
machen wobei 192.168.0.20 die Adresse von meinem Server ist. Falls andere auch das Problem haben.
Danke nochmals und jetzt geht's ans Update -
0.0.0.0 ist auch ok.
Damit ist gemeint, dass falls Du mehrere Netzwerk-Interfaces im Rechner hast (z.B. WLAN und Ethernet - bekommen ja jeweils eine eigene IP-Adresse), der Admin auf allen Adressen gebunden wird und damit über alle Interfaces erreichbar ist.
-
@apollon77 Finde ich wieder so ein rumgepfusche. Lieber erst mal darauf hinweisen und eine vernünftige Dauer-Lösung ausarbeiten.
-
@AlCalzone Klar war das mit Kanonen auf Spatzen. Da ich aber anfangs nicht wusste was ich so alles mal in Skripten verwende, war es eben bequem alles zuzulassen. So war es ja früher auch, daher war die neue Sicherheit mit Einschränkungen für mich verbunden.
Aktuell brauche ich diese Kommandos mit root:pkill rfkill reboot apt update apt list
@crycode, @apollon77, @SBorg Zum simple-api Problem habe ich einen neuen Thread aufgemacht:
https://forum.iobroker.net/topic/26809/simple-api-mit-benutzerauthentifizierung -
@Diginix alle genannte Kommandos wären für mich ok standardmäßig hinzuzufügen. Man kann nicht viel Böses damit anstellen...
-
@Superdad Identisch auf meinem testsystem - nur Port auf 9081 ... Der Login Tut. Admin 3.6.12. Welche Rechte hat denn die Gruppe in der der user ist?
-
@Diginix
apt *
geht,reboot
geht. Die anderen beiden klingen vernünftig. -
admin ist Administrator und hat alle Rechte.
-
@Superdad Tut bei mir auch mit admin sofort und so
-
Keine Ahnung was verkehrt läuft??????????????
-
@Superdad mal Browser cache geleert oder Mal mit nem anderen Browser versucht?
-
Hallo,
mein Upgrade auf 2.1 ist eigentlich ganz gut gelaufen nur die Bilder für @sigi234 Wetter vis fehlen weil diese im daswetter adapter Ordner liegen. Jetzt wollte ich diese nach 0_userdata.0 verschieben finde aber den besagten Ordner nicht.
Unter Objekte sehe ich 0_userdata.0 mit dem Demo state und konnte auch einen neuen anlegen, aber wo finde ich den Ordner um Sigis Wetter/Mond Bilder dort hinzuschieben?
Host "iobroker" (linux) updated Execute: chmod -R 777 /opt/iobroker ch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/2.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/29.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/23.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/10.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/1.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/3.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/12.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/19.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/16.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/5.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/20.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/27.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/22.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/6.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/24.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/26.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/11.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/4.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/13.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/25.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/8.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/28.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/21.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/17.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/18.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/7.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/14.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/9.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/MondHD/15.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/2.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/10.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/1.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/3.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/12.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/19.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/16.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/5.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/6.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/11.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/4.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/13.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/8.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/17.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/18.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/7.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/14.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/9.png': Die Operation ist nicht erlaubt chmod: Beim Setzen der Zugriffsrechte für '/opt/iobroker/iobroker-data/files/daswetter.admin/icons/WetterHD/15.png': Die Operation ist nicht erlaubt Chmod finished. Restart controller Starting node restart.js
Danke
Andi -
root@iobroker:/opt/iobroker/iobroker-data# iobroker file sync 48 file(s) successfully synchronized with ioBroker storage The following notifications happened during sync: - Added 48 Files in Directory "daswetter.admin" - Ignoring Directory "sayit.0" because officially not created as meta object. Please remove directory! root@iobroker:/opt/iobroker/iobroker-data#
Hat erstmal die Bilder wiedergebracht, hat jemand eine Idee warum sayit.0 gelöscht werden soll? Directory wurde vom Adapter selbst angelegt.
-
@A-H-0 sagte in js-controller 2 jetzt für alle im Stable:
because officially not created as meta object.
Wie hast du das Verzeichnis angelegt?
-
wurde vom Sysit Adapter bei der Installation angelegt:
drwxrwxrwx+ 3 iobroker iobroker 4096 Jul 31 22:28 sayit.0
drwxrwxrwx+ 2 iobroker iobroker 4096 Jul 31 22:28 sayit.admin -
@A-H-0 sagte:
because officially not created as meta object
Es gibt viele Instanzen die kein Objekt sind, sondern nur eine Ordner-Struktur.
-
@A-H-0 sagte in js-controller 2 jetzt für alle im Stable:
Hallo,
mein Upgrade auf 2.1 ist eigentlich ganz gut gelaufen nur die Bilder für @sigi234 Wetter vis fehlen weil diese im daswetter adapter Ordner liegen. Jetzt wollte ich diese nach 0_userdata.0 verschieben finde aber den besagten Ordner nicht.
Unter Objekte sehe ich 0_userdata.0 mit dem Demo state und konnte auch einen neuen anlegen, aber wo finde ich den Ordner um Sigis Wetter/Mond Bilder dort hinzuschieben?
Danke
AndiIcons unter vis.0 nochmal mit dem Dateimanager rauf kopieren.
@apollon77 sagte in js-controller 2 jetzt für alle im Stable:
Skripte müssen angepasst werden (Nutzung von writeFile) bzw. die Dateien müssen in offiziell definierte Adpater-Basisverzeichnisse (z.B. vis.0, iqontrol.meta u.ä.) abgelegt werden. Nutzt am besten auch die offiziellen Uploader von Vis oder iqontrol, damit diese Dateien korrekt registriert sind.
-
Kann man dieses Thema zum js-controller 2 bitte anpinnen bzw in Announcements verlinken?
In den Announcements wird auf die veraltete Version 1.5.x verwiesen, das erschwert etwas das Auffinden von wichtigen Informationen zu diesem Update auf Version 2.
Danke.
-
@sigi234 Versuch mal bei gestopptem iobroker ein "iobroker file sync" Was ist die Ausgabe?
Ansonsten gab es auch einen vis Bug <1.2.1 oder so der Bilder kaputt hochgeladen hat
-
@umbm Zweites erledigt, Announcement mache ich nachher noch! Danke für den Hinweis